Description of key information

No pyrophoricity

Non flammable

No flammability on contact with water

Not self-heating

Key value for chemical safety assessment

Flammability:
not classified

Additional information

Non pyrophoric, non flammable and not self-heating solid.

Based on the chemical structure and experience in handling and use, flammability on contact with water is not to be expected.

Justification for classification or non-classification

The available data on flammability, pyrophoricity and flammbility in contact with water do not meet the criteria for classification according to Regulation (EC) 1272/2008 or Directive 67/548/EEC and are therefore conclusive but not sufficient for classification: Based on the chemical structure and experience in handling and use, pyrophoricity and flammability in contact with water are not expected.
